   JACK MAIN
THIS PICTURE OF MYSELF AND MARTHA MYERS WAS TAKEN AROUND 1948 OR 49, THE BURRO I AM RIDING WAS CAPTURED FROM A WILD HERD FROM BELOW DAVID HILL BY BOB BLAIR AND GIVEN TO BUCK MAIN.  HE WAS ON THE RANCH FOR YEARS AND I USED HIM TO CLOWN AT THE FFA RODEOS HELD IN ROY.  HE WAS WELL KNOWN IN HARDING COUNTY WHERE I USED TO DRIVE HIM AROUND WITH A SULKY MADE FROM AN OLD PLOW.  I THINK HE CRAPED ON EVERY SIDEWALK IN TOWN.
Jack Main on Burro & Martha Myers
